Brown (2018), Kevin, Reflections on Relativity, 2018 ' . . . general relativity teaches us that the principles of special relativity are applicable only over infinitesimal regions in the presence of gravitation, so in a sense the general theory restricts rather than generalizes the special theory. However, we can also regard special relativity as a theory of flat four-dimensional spacetime, characterized by the Minkowski metric (in suitable coordinates), and the general theory generalizes this by allowing the spacetime manifold to be curved, as represented by a wider class of metric tensors. It is remarkable that this generalization, which is so simple and natural from the geometrical standpoint, leads almost uniquely to a viable theory of gravitation.' (page 700)

Aquinas, Summa I, 25, 3, Is God omnipotent?, '. . . God is called omnipotent because He can do all things that are possible absolutely; which is the second way of saying a thing is possible. For a thing is said to be possible or impossible absolutely, according to the relation in which the very terms stand to one another, possible if the predicate is not incompatible with the subject, as that Socrates sits; and absolutely impossible when the predicate is altogether incompatible with the subject, as, for instance, that a man is a donkey.' back

CERN CMS Collaboration, Life of the Higgs Boson, 'The Higgs boson is peculiar in many respects. Like most other elementary particles, it is unstable and lives only for an extremely short time, 1.6 x 10^-22 seconds, according to the established theory of particle physics (the standard model). [. . .]
Measuring the Higgs boson lifetime poses a big experimental challenge, though. The lifetime is almost a billion times too short for the Higgs boson to fly a measurable distance in the detector before decaying into other particles. On the other hand, the lifetime is also too long to be measured through the range of possible variations of its nominal mass (125 GeV/c^2), allowed by Heisenberg’s uncertainty principle. Because of this quantum effect, the mass of an unstable particle can vary around its nominal value in a range (called the width) that is inversely proportional to its lifetime. The predicted width of the Higgs boson mass range (about 0.0041 GeV/c2) is about 200 times too small to be resolved by the detector, unfortunately.' back

Edward Moore (Internet Encyclopdia of Philoaophy), Gnosticism, ' Gnosticism (after gnôsis, the Greek word for “knowledge” or “insight”) is the name given to a loosely organized religious and philosophical movement that flourished in the first and second centuries CE. The exact origin(s) of this school of thought cannot be traced, although it is possible to locate influences or sources as far back as the second and first centuries BCE, such as the early treatises of the Corpus Hermeticum, the Jewish Apocalyptic writings, and especially Platonic philosophy and the Hebrew Scriptures themselves.
In spite of the diverse nature of the various Gnostic sects and teachers, certain fundamental elements serve to bind these groups together under the loose heading of “Gnosticism” or “Gnosis.” Chief among these elements is a certain manner of “anti-cosmic world rejection” that has often been mistaken for mere dualism. According to the Gnostics, this world, the material cosmos, is the result of a primordial error on the part of a supra-cosmic, supremely divine being, usually called Sophia (Wisdom) or simply the Logos. Electroweak interaction - Wikipedia, Electroweak interaction - Wikipedia, the free encyclopedia, ' In particle physics, the electroweak interaction or electroweak force is the unified description of two of the four known fundamental interactions of nature: electromagnetism and the weak interaction. Although these two forces appear very different at everyday low energies, the theory models them as two different aspects of the same force. Above the unification energy, on the order of 246 GeV, they would merge into a single force.' back

Formalism (philosophy of mathematics) - Wikipedia, Formalism (philosophy of mathematics) - Wikipedia, the free encyclopedia, 'In the philosophy of mathematics, formalism is the view that holds that statements of mathematics and logic can be considered to be statements about the consequences of the manipulation of strings (alphanumeric sequences of symbols, usually as equations) using established manipulation rules. A central idea of formalism "is that mathematics is not a body of propositions representing an abstract sector of reality, but is much more akin to a game, bringing with it no more commitment to an ontology of objects or properties than ludo or chess."
A major figure of formalism was David Hilbert, whose program was intended to be a complete and consistent axiomatization of all of mathematics.[9] Hilbert aimed to show the consistency of mathematical systems from the assumption that the "finitary arithmetic" (a subsystem of the usual arithmetic of the positive integers, chosen to be philosophically uncontroversial) was consistent (i.e. no contradictions can be derived from the system). back

Haixu Wu et al, (2026_06_18, Lamprey 3D single-cell transcriptomics reveals ancestral and specialized features of the vertebrate brain, ' Editor’s summary The jawless vertebrate lamprey has a relatively simple brain, and understanding how it works could unveil valuable insights into brain evolution in vertebrates. Wu et al. combined single-nucleus RNA sequencing and spatial transcriptomics to produce a three-dimensional atlas of the adult lamprey’s brain. The authors identified 209 molecular and spatially distinct cell clusters and compared single-cell data for eight species and spatial transcriptomics for five species. They found regional conservation among species and lineage-specific divergence at the cellular level. Overall, the dataset revealed principles of brain evolution and diversification in vertebrates.' —Mattia Maroso back

On Heroes, Hero-Worship, & the Heroic in History - Wikipedia, On Heroes, Hero-Worship, & the Heroic in History - Wikipedia, the free encyclopedia, ' On Heroes, Hero-Worship, & the Heroic in History is a book by the Scottish essayist, historian and philosopher Thomas Carlyle, published by James Fraser, London, in 1841. It is a collection of six lectures given in May 1840 about prominent historical figures. It lays out Carlyle's belief in the importance of heroic leadership.
Carlyle was one of the few philosophers who lived through the British Industrial Revolution but maintained a non-materialistic view of historical development. The book included lectures discussing people ranging from the field of religion through to literature and politics. The figures chosen for each lecture were presented by Carlyle as archetypal examples of individuals who, in their respective fields of endeavour, had dramatically impacted history in some way. The Islamic prophet Muhammad found a place in the book in the lecture titled "The Hero as Prophet". In his work, Carlyle outlined Muhammad as a Hegelian agent of reform, insisting on his sincerity and commenting "how one man single-handedly, could weld warring tribes and wandering Bedouins into a most powerful and civilized nation in less than two decades". His interpretation has been widely cited by Muslim scholars to show Muhammad without orientalist bias. back

Requiem (Verdi) - Wikipedia, Requiem (Verdi) - Wikipedia, the free ncyclopedia, ' The Messa da Requiem is a musical setting of the Catholic funeral mass (Requiem) for four soloists, double choir and orchestra by Giuseppe Verdi. It was composed in memory of Alessandro Manzoni, whom Verdi admired, and is therefore also referred to as the Manzoni Requiem. The first performance, at the San Marco church in Milan on 22 May 1874, conducted by the composer, marked the first anniversary of Manzoni's death. It was followed three days later by the same performers at La Scala. Verdi conducted his work at major venues in Europe.
Verdi composed the music for the last part of the text, Libera me, first, as his contribution to the Messa per Rossini, which he had begun after Gioachino Rossini had died.
Considered too operatic to be performed in a liturgical setting, the Requiem is usually given in concert form; a performance lasts around 90 minutes. Musicologist David Rosen calls it "probably the most frequently performed major choral work composed after Mozart's Requiem".

Yoichiro Nambu (2008_12_08), Spontaneous symmetry breaking in particle physics: A case of cross fertilization, ' SSB in a medium then has the following characteristic properties: 1. the ground state has huge degeneracy. a symmetry operation takes one ground state to another. 2. only one of the ground states and a complete set of excited states built on it are realized in a give situation. 3. SSB is in general lost at sufficiently high temperatures.
In relativistic quantum field theory, this phenomenon becomes also possible for the entire space-time, for the “vacuum” is not void, but has many intrinsic degrees of freedom. In this context, it may play an important role in cosmology. as the universe expands and cools down, it may undergo one or more SSB phase transitions from states of higher symmetries to lower ones, which change the governing laws of physics. [. . .]
Finally I will end this lecture with a comment on the mass hierarchy problem. hierarchical structure is an outstanding feature of the universe. The masses of known fundamental fermions also make a hierarchy stretching 11 orders of magnitude. Mass is not quantized in a simple regular manner like charge and spin. Mass is a dynamical quantity since it receives contributions from interactions. But we do not see yet a pattern like those in the hydrogen atom, which led to quantum mechanics, or the regge trajectories, which led to the dual string picture.
the BcS mechanism seems relevant to the problem, as was remarked earlier. it generates a mass gap for fermions, plus the nambu-goldstone and higgs modes as low-lying bosons. The bosons may act in turn as an agent for further SSB, leading to the possibility of hierarchical SSB or “tumbling”.
In fact we already have examples of it
1. the chain atoms – crystal – phonon – superconductivity. the ng mode for crystal formation is the phonon, which induces the cooper pairing of electrons to cause superconductivity>br> 2. the chain QcD – chiral SSB of quarks and baryons – π, σ and other mesons – nuclei formation and nucleon pairing – nuclear collective modes.
